DAC8560 | DAC8560 16-Bit, Ultra-Low Glitch, Voltage Output Digital-to-Analog Converter With 2.5-V, 2-ppm/°C Internal Reference 1 Features 1• Relative Accuracy: 4 LSB • Glitch Energy: 0.15 nV-s • MicroPower Operation: 510 μA at 2.7 V • Internal Reference: – 2.5-V Reference Voltage (Enabled by Default) – 0.02% Initial Accuracy – 2-ppm/°C Temperature Drift (Typical) – 5-ppm/°C Temperature Drift (Maximum) – 20-mA | TI 德州仪器 | ||
DAC8560 | 具有 2.5V、2ppm/°C 基准的 16 位、单通道、低功耗、超低干扰、电压输出 DAC | TI 德州仪器 | ||
